Jim Robb will deliver the keynote address on August 12 at Basin Electric's 2026 Annual Meeting of the Membership.
Robb is the president and chief executive officer of the North American Electric Reliability Corporation (NERC), where he leads the organization responsible for ensuring the reliability and security of the bulk power system across North America. In this role, he guides industrywide efforts related to reliability standards, system performance, security preparedness, and long-term grid resilience.
Since joining the Electric Reliability Organization (ERO) Enterprise in 2013, Robb has led both regional and North American-wide efforts to strengthen grid performance. Before his tenure at NERC and the Western Electricity Coordinating Council, he spent more than three decades in the energy sector as an engineer, consultant, and senior executive, including leadership roles at Northeast Utilities, Reliant Energy, and McKinsey & Company. His career has spanned work on electric system evolution, cybersecurity, natural gas-electric interdependence, and the integration of emerging generation technologies.
With more than three decades of experience in engineering, consulting, and executive leadership, Robb is a sought-after speaker on the future of the grid and the operational and security challenges facing the energy sector.
